  1. 14 lip 2020 · Year-round, the Cinque Terre Express train connects La Spezia to Levanto to the north, stopping in all five towns along the way. The villages are all just minutes apart from one another, and trains frequently run, especially from spring to fall. A one-way ticket between two destinations costs 4 euros (as of May 2020).

  6. 1 gru 2023 · Map of the Blue Trail & Cinque Terre towns. Each of the 5 towns and hiking distances between them are displayed on the map below: Monterosso; Vernazza: from Monterosso: 3.7 km, 2 hr; Corniglia: from Vernazza: 3.5 km, 2 hr; Manarola: from Corniglia: 2.7 km, 30 min; Riomaggiore: from Manorola: 1.3 km, 30 min; All 4 hikes: 11 km, 5-6 hours.

  7. 21 mar 2015 · The Cinque Terre means “five lands” which are the five villages of Riomaggiore, Manarola, Corniglia, Vernazza and Monterosso al Mare. But just think of the region as a spider web of trails, towns, and villages. This stretch of coastline is a mix of tiny hamlets, like Groppo, and bigger towns like La Spezia and Levanto.
